The HSRC working together with partners,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), South African Medical Research Council (SAMRC), the University of Cape Town (UCT), and the National Institute for Communicable Diseases (NICD), and PEPFAR South Africa, have the pleasure of inviting you to the launch of the national fieldwork implementation of the 6th national HIV household survey (South African National HIV Prevalence, Incidence, Behaviour and Communication Survey known as the 2021 South African HIV Behavioural, Sero-status and Media survey or SABSSM VI for short). The survey is marking its 20th anniversary since the first survey was commissioned and funded by former President Nelson Mandela through the Nelson Mandela Foundation in 2001.

This survey will be the largest survey ever conducted by the HSRC, with approximately 93 000 participants expected to be interviewed and 65 000 blood specimens collected for laboratory testing. This information will help us combat the spread of HIV through ART medication and SABSSM VI will determine HIV incidence, prevalence, antiretroviral treatment use, viral load suppression, HIV drug resistance, HIV risk behaviours, SARS-CoV-2 antibodies, and sources and modalities of HIV communication. In addition, COVID-19 antibody testing will be included to estimate the proportion of infection at national and provincial level.  Data collection at national, provincial, and district level provides strategic insight into the progression of the epidemic, and therefore this survey series is critical for the country’s HIV/AIDS response.
